Background technique
Livestock-raising is that the livestock of a kind of pair of large area carries out a kind of stable breeding device of same cultivation with cultivation circle, is come with this Achieve the effect that conveniently to carry out same feeding and cultivation to same livestock, although however the type of the cultivation circle on existing market With it is large number of, but it is during carrying out use, or there is some problems;
1, during cultivating to livestock, feeding situations cannot be carried out to livestock well, and fed In the process, feed and water source cannot be subjected to separated feeding well, so that entire cultivation circle is internal to will appear a large amount of feeds Into the phenomenon inside water source, feed is caused to will appear waste, water source will appear pollution, can not be good to internal environment Guaranteed, as being by the feed area of livestock and rest area inside a kind of pig-breeding colony house of application number CN20112042629 Separate, but not basic solution feed and waste and contamination phenomenon;
2, after water source and feed are fed, water source and feed cannot be recycled very well, lead to feed and water The phenomenon that being easy to appear dampness in the long-term environment in opening in source and pollute;
3, during being fed to water source and feed, the delivery work that cannot be automated well, so that cultivation Circle needs staff constantly to progress feed inside the trough inside each cultivation circle in the work fed It devotes oneself to work, increases the amount of labour of staff.
So facilitating the livestock-raising cultivation for carrying out feeding to enclose we have proposed a kind of, in order to solve to propose among the above The problem of.

The working principle of the present embodiment: when facilitating the livestock-raising for carrying out feeding cultivation circle using this, firstly, work Personnel open baffle 2, and the inside for needing the livestock for carrying out stable breeding to be placed on cultivation circle main body 1 is carried out cultivation work, is being cultivated During, if livestock needs to be fed in the inside of cultivation circle main body 1, according to Fig. 1, Fig. 4-6 and Fig. 8, work people Member by the water pipe 14 on each cultivation circle 1 inside support rod of main body, 3 top and air hose 15 respectively with extraneous two way water pump and two-way Blower is attached work, then, it is only necessary to which extraneous two way water pump and two-way blower fan is respectively started in staff, and then two-way Extraneous water source can be entered the placing groove 22 inside holding tray 7 by water pipe 14, water inlet 5 and blanking tube 13 by water pump Inside, then, start motor 17 so that motor 17 drive motor shaft 18 rotate, motor shaft 18 rotate third rotating disk 19 revolve It rotates into and rotates the first rotating disk 8, then the first rotating disk 8 drive is coaxially connected with it The rotation of the second rotating disk 12 connect rotates so that the feed belt 9 outside the second rotating disk 12 is rotated in feed belt 9 In the process, it can make the connector 11 above it that connecting rod 10 and holding tray 7 be driven to carry out lifting work, in the mistake gone up and down Cheng Zhong, the holding tray 7 for just having filled water source, which drops to the ground of cultivation circle main body 1, to carry out for livestock using filling putting for water When setting disk 7 and dropping to minimum point, another holding tray 7 on feed belt 9 will be increased to the bottom of blanking tube 13, then, Staff starts two-way blower fan, so that extraneous feed is passed through each air hose 15, feed inlet 6 and blanking tube 13 by two-way blower fan The top of holding tray 7 is entered, later, above-mentioned feed belt 9 is repeated in the transmission work of the second rotating disk 12, will to fill The holding tray 7 of full feed drops to cultivation circle 1 bottom livestock of main body and is eaten, and thus just ensure that livestock is carrying out well It is not in the mixing wasting phenomenon of water source and feed during feed;
After the completion of livestock is intake with feeding, according to Fig. 3-8, the holding tray 7 after the completion of feeding can be again in feed belt 9 Under the action of be increased to the bottom of blanking tube 13, when holding tray 7 reaches the bottom of blanking tube 13 again, due to water source and feed Feed and water source tail off after all edible, and then the two sides weight above the placing groove 22 holding tray 7 inside is just made to become smaller, Meeting under the action of compressed spring 2202 so that the two sides of placing groove 22 in shaft 2201, the effect of sliding block 2203 and sliding groove 701 Under risen, extra water source and feed are tilted and reach corresponding with the blanking tube 13 horizontal structure of placing groove 22 Extraneous two way water pump and two-way blower fan is respectively started in the top of position, then, staff, can will be deposited in placing groove The water source or feed of 22 tops recycle again, to complete a series of activities.
